LOCAL: Spring sports seasons ramping up

The Saint Jo High School track and field team was the first to open the season on Feb. 25 at Paradise High School.

A track meet originally scheduled for Feb. 25 in Henrietta was cancelled on account of the Bearcat boys’ basketball team still competing in the University Interscholastic League playoffs.
Bowie was to compete in that event.
Instead, Bowie will open the season on Feb. 29 with a junior high school meet at Nocona also featuring the host Indians, Gold-Burg, Forestburg and Saint Jo.
There will be a high school meet at Nocona on March 3, with Bowie, Gold-Burg, Forestburg, Saint Jo and Nocona all in action.

Bowie golf

The Bowie High School boys’ golf team will begin the regular season on Feb. 29 with a tournament at Graham.
The tournament is set to begin with a 9 a.m. shotgun start.

Bowie, Nocona compete in VB scrimmages

Nocona’s volleyball team headed to Bowie for a three-team scrimmage with the host team and Ponder Aug. 7.

Each team played the other two for 30 minutes in the Lady Rabbit gym. Lady Indian Coach Sandy Langford said she thought things went well for a first scrimmage.

“Just like any young team that is trying to find itself in a first scrimmage, We looked really good at times and at others not so much,” Langford said. “We’re forming a new team after losing a lot of seniors.”

Langford said the squad would have one thing go wrong and it would explode into several things. That will need to stop for a successful year in Langford’s mind.

Rabbit netters beat Graham

Bowie’s tennis team is now 3-3 for the non-district campaign with a 1-2 week.

In the Rabbits’ home opener Aug. 5 against Graham, Bowie posted a 13-6 match win with the girls completing a 9-0 sweep.

Jessi Mayfield and Angeles Alvarez won 9-8 (7-4) while Payton Goodwin and Maddie Schwarz were 8-1 winners as were Avery DeWeber and Avery Bonham.

In girl’s singles Willow Seibert won 8-2 in No.1 1 singles. Goodwin  and Mayfield were each 8-5 winners. Alvarez posted an 8-1 win. Schwarz won 9-8 (8-5) with Deweber taking an 8-2 decision.

New Nocona gym nearing completion

Two major portions of Nocona’s 2023 bond issue are very close to being completed.

The new high school gym should be complete in time for the volleyball team to begin practice there Aug. 1, according to Superintendent Dr. David Waters. Ground on the 22,000 square foot facility was broken on Oct. 18, 2024.

Waters said a punch list meeting with the construction manager was scheduled for earlier this week with final touchups expected shortly afterwards. Fans should be able to enjoy the facility for the volleyball team’s season opener Aug. 11.

Fans will enjoy the new gym from entering the facility which has glass walls, enabling fans to watch the game from the foyer. Once inside the gym itself, there is stadium, chair back seating on the home side allowing for a much more comfortable experience.
